
C语言编程题,在线等答案啊~~
编程题:20个学生某门功课成绩存于一实数模型数组中,求最高分、最低分,平均分。高级语言设计的题目,很急,在线等答案哦~~~还有一道:将一字符串从第m个字符开始的全部字符复...
编程题:20个学生某门功课成绩存于一实数模型数组中,求最高分、最低分,平均分。
高级语言设计的题目,很急,在线等答案哦~~~
还有一道:将一字符串从第m个字符开始的全部字符复制成为另一个字符串,要求从主函数中输入源字符串和m的值,被调函数完成复制功能,最后在主函数中输出
目标字符串。(用指针法)
谢谢大家了~~
能先有一道的答案就先给一道的吧~~
希望没有诚意的人不要在这瞎掺和可以吗?题目就写着是编程题,如果觉得太简单,就请绕过,如果知道怎么编程,我也不上这来问了,谢谢~ 展开
高级语言设计的题目,很急,在线等答案哦~~~
还有一道:将一字符串从第m个字符开始的全部字符复制成为另一个字符串,要求从主函数中输入源字符串和m的值,被调函数完成复制功能,最后在主函数中输出
目标字符串。(用指针法)
谢谢大家了~~
能先有一道的答案就先给一道的吧~~
希望没有诚意的人不要在这瞎掺和可以吗?题目就写着是编程题,如果觉得太简单,就请绕过,如果知道怎么编程,我也不上这来问了,谢谢~ 展开
2个回答
展开全部
#include <stdio.h>
#include <time.h>
#include <stdlib.h>
void main()
{
int grade[20],max=0,min=0,sum=0;
srand((unsigned)time(NULL));
printf("学生成绩初始化:\n");
for(int i=0;i<20;i++)
{
grade[i]=rand()%100;
printf("学生%d的成绩为:%d\n",i+1,grade[i]);
if(grade[i]<grade[min])
min=i;
if(grade[i]>grade[max])
max=i;
sum+=grade[i];
}
printf("最高分:%d,最低分:%d,平均分:%.3f\n",grade[max],grade[min],(float)sum/20);
}
#include <time.h>
#include <stdlib.h>
void main()
{
int grade[20],max=0,min=0,sum=0;
srand((unsigned)time(NULL));
printf("学生成绩初始化:\n");
for(int i=0;i<20;i++)
{
grade[i]=rand()%100;
printf("学生%d的成绩为:%d\n",i+1,grade[i]);
if(grade[i]<grade[min])
min=i;
if(grade[i]>grade[max])
max=i;
sum+=grade[i];
}
printf("最高分:%d,最低分:%d,平均分:%.3f\n",grade[max],grade[min],(float)sum/20);
}
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询